Spa Spillover
When spa spillover is “Enabled”, the homeowner will be able to rotate through “Pool Only”
(both suction and return valves switched to pool), “Spa Only” (both suction and return
valves switched to spa) and “Spillover” (suction valve switched to pool and return valve
switched to spa) by successive presses of the “Pool/Spa) button.
Filter Operation
If “Spa Spillover” is selected, the Aqua Logic will automatically switch the pool/spa suction
and return valves to the “spillover” at the start of the programmed pool filtering time period
or when the super-chlorinate function is turned on. The valves will remain in this position for
the remainder of the super-chlorinate period. This option is usually preferable because both
the pool and spa water will be filtered and sanitized.
If “Pool Only” is selected, then the Aqua Logic will switch the pool/spa valves to the “pool
only” position during super chlorinate. This may be desirable on some systems with in-floor
cleaners because it allows the cleaner to operate all the time the pool is being filtered and/or
the super chlorinate is running.

Lights Name
The Aqua Logic allows you to assign any one of a number of names (eg “Pool Light, Spa
Light, Deck Light, etc) to this control function. Note that other lights may be assigned to
some of the Aux outputs. This will make the Aqua Logic much more user friendly to the
homeowner when they want to turn various lights on or off. A sheet of small name labels is
included with the Aqua Logic main unit and each remote display/keypad so that the “Lights”
pushbutton can be labeled the same as the name that you have assigned. At this time it is
also a good idea to make sure that the relay in the control box is also labeled (hand written)
with the same name as a help to technicians who may service this system at a later date.
Lights Function
Manual On/Off—the lights relay will alternate between turning on and off when the LIGHTS
button is pressed. There is no automatic control logic.
Countdown Timer—the lights relay will turn on when the LIGHTS button is pressed. The
lights relay will turn off automatically after a programmed time (see Timers Menu in the
Operations Manual). The LIGHTS button can also be used to turn the output off.
Timeclock – the lights will turn-on and turn-off at the times set for the lights timeclock in the
Settings Menu (see Operations Manual). The LIGHTS button can also be used to turn the
output on and off.
